EMSA awards €30m framework to Airbus for Flexrotor maritime surveillance drones

The European Maritime Safety Agency has awarded Airbus a €30 million framework contract to provide its Flexrotor remotely piloted aircraft for multipurpose maritime surveillance across member states, covering aircraft provision and mission support to enhance EU-wide maritime monitoring and response capabilities.

What Hype is tracking

  • The €30 million framework is a concrete procurement by a major EU agency that commits Airbus Flexrotor platforms to EMSAs maritime surveillance fleet, signalling short-term budgeted demand and operational deployments.

  • The award supports the expansion of BVLOS and UTM-enabled maritime drone operations in Europe, building on recent integrations that aim to scale beyond-line-of-sight unmanned missions (see the uAvionix/OneSky UTM integration: https://hype.aero/?story=b9557fdf-7116-4423-8783-b8d922ac4d45).

  • It underscores growing interest and competition in maritime UAV solutions alongside other naval-focused programmes, such as the U.S. Navys selection of a maritime Firefly UAV variant (https://hype.aero/?story=4057637e-46f6-4e6c-b254-a8cf3e4d101a).
